JavaScript 是一種非常流行的編程語言,廣泛用于 web 前端開發。在這個過程中,我們通常需要與其他人分享自己編寫的 JavaScript 代碼。今天,我們將介紹一些常用的方法來共享 JavaScript 代碼。
一個最簡單的方法是將代碼放在一個 HTML 文件中,然后將這個文件發送給需要的人。下面是一個示例:
<html> <head> <script> function greet(name) { console.log('Hello ' + name); } greet('John'); </script> </head> <body> </body> </html>
這個例子中,我們定義了一個簡單的函數 greet(),然后在頁面加載后調用這個函數。如果你將整個代碼復制到一個 HTML 文件中并發送給他人,他們就可以在本地運行這段代碼了。
另一個常見的方法是將代碼放在共享代碼庫(如 Github)中,并允許其他人使用該代碼或提交貢獻。下面是一個簡單的示例:
// 數組的平均值 function average(numbers) { let sum = numbers.reduce(function(total, num) { return total + num; }, 0); return sum / numbers.length; } // 導出平均值函數 module.exports = average;
在這個例子中,我們定義了一個計算數組平均值的函數 average(),然后使用 CommonJS 模塊系統將這個函數導出。其他人可以通過導入這個模塊來使用這個函數。
此外,為了更好地與其他開發者交流和協作,我們可以使用代碼托管和版本控制工具。其中最流行的是 Git 和 Github。
最后,我們還可以將 JavaScript 代碼打包為庫或框架,讓其他人可以更方便地使用。對于這個目的,常用的打包工具有 webpack 和 Rollup。
以上是一些常用的方法來共享 JavaScript 代碼。無論是通過 HTML 文件、共享代碼庫還是打包為庫或框架,我們都可以選取合適的方式來與他人分享我們編寫的 JavaScript 代碼。